Warriors basketball plays CSP‑Solano Wolverines

Warriors coaching academy and team played a game at Solano prison against the Level II All-Star Wolverines.

In late February, the Warriors Basketball Coaching Academy, along with their recreational team, visited California State Prison (CSP) Solano, for an exhibition game.

The event was held Feb. 22, pitting the Warriors recreational team against the Solano Level II All-Star Wolverines.

The Warriors team were greeted warmly by the Solano team and spectators. Atmosphere before the game was festive with music provided by a live band that brought a lot of excitement to the gym.

After the national anthem was sung the game began. The game was off to a slow start, and defense dominated the first quarter. By the end of the first quarter, the Warriors led 16-11. 

The second quarter saw the Wolverines made an adjustment to their gameplay and were only behind by 3 points, 29-26, at halftime.

During the halftime show, a participant from the first Twinning Project cohort, performed a song he dedicated to the Warriors academy.

The Warriors started the second half with smothering defense, making it tough for the Wolverines to score. Dez, John, and Tone made bucket after bucket. Before the Wolverines could recover, they were down 49-32 at the end of the third quarter.

The Wolverines made a comeback in the fourth quarter scoring 22 points, but it was too little and too late. In the end, the Warriors won the game 66-54.

After the game, the players shook hands and mingled, swapped stories and talked about everything from game moments to rehabilitation. Staff, visitors, and incarcerated individuals said they enjoyed a day full of laughter, basketball, sportsmanship, and rehabilitative fun.
